Story Behind The Song

Newport Jazz festival 1956. Duke Ellington's career revived by a stunning 27 chorus solo by saxophonist Paul Gonsalves.

Song Description

A tribute song designed for a big band to pick up and improvise the middle section. The theme is the Duke Ellington band's performance at the 1956 Newport Jazz Festival. A famous performance in the history of Jazz.
